Output 73cdafd5d0faff0bb191324efeddd5e1e4c839a12b758ff8ea4660b4834b5ecc:1

value
1678
script pubkey
OP_0 OP_PUSHBYTES_20 50393e101af18eb93189b49a8643e90c7e49b026
address
bc1q2qunuyq67x8tjvvfkjdgvslfp3lynvpxp3036l
transaction
73cdafd5d0faff0bb191324efeddd5e1e4c839a12b758ff8ea4660b4834b5ecc
confirmations
185943
spent
true